Step 2: Water Supply & Plumbing Integration
Proper water supply is fundamental to any outdoor shower. We evaluate your existing plumbing system to determine the most efficient way to bring water to your new shower. Our options include:
- Hot and Cold Water: Extending existing hot and cold lines for a comfortable showering experience year-round. This often involves insulated piping to protect against temperature fluctuations.
- Single-Temperature (Cold Only): A simpler option for basic rinsing needs, ideal for quick cool-downs.
- Dedicated Water Heater Options: For locations where extending existing hot water lines is not feasible, we can explore tankless water heaters or solar-powered solutions specifically for your outdoor shower, ensuring consistent hot water.
We ensure all connections are secure, leak-proof, and designed to withstand the coastal environment.
Step 3: Effective Drainage Solutions Tailored for Wadmalaw
Adequate drainage is crucial for preventing water accumulation, erosion, and potential issues with your home's foundation. Given Wadmalaw's soil types and proximity to water, we offer several drainage solutions:
- Simple Gravel Beds: A permeable base allowing water to naturally percolate into the ground. Suitable for areas with good soil absorption.
- French Drains: An underground system that channels water away from the shower area to a more suitable drainage point, preventing saturation.
- Connection to Existing Drainage/Septic System: For a more integrated solution, water can be directed to your main septic or sewer system, requiring careful planning and adherence to local regulations.
- Eco-Friendly Greywater Systems: For environmentally conscious homeowners, we can explore systems that divert shower water for landscape irrigation, reducing water waste.
Our team ensures the chosen drainage method is effective, sustainable, and compliant with local environmental guidelines.
Step 4: Material Selection & Enclosure Construction
The materials chosen for your outdoor shower enclosure must withstand Wadmalaw's salt air, humidity, and sun exposure. We guide you through options that offer both durability and aesthetic appeal:
- Cedar & Teak: Naturally resistant to rot, insects, and moisture, these woods weather beautifully over time, providing a classic, coastal look.
- Composite Materials: Low-maintenance, highly durable, and resistant to fading, scratching, and warping, ideal for a long-lasting structure.
- PVC & Vinyl: Cost-effective, lightweight, and completely impervious to water and rot, offering a clean, modern appearance.
- Natural Stone & Tile: For a more luxurious and permanent feel, these materials offer exceptional durability and endless design possibilities.
- Marine-Grade Fixtures: All showerheads, valves, and hardware are selected for their corrosion resistance, ensuring longevity in a coastal setting.
We consider how each material choice will complement your home's architecture and the surrounding landscape, integrating seamlessly with your Wadmalaw aesthetic.

Maintaining Your Outdoor Shower in Wadmalaw
To ensure your outdoor shower remains beautiful and functional, proper maintenance is essential:
- Regular Cleaning: Periodically clean the enclosure and fixtures to prevent mold, mildew, and mineral buildup, especially in humid coastal conditions.
- Material-Specific Care: Follow recommendations for your chosen materials (e.g., oiling teak, cleaning composite surfaces).
- Winterization: While Wadmalaw's winters are mild, it’s wise to properly drain and protect outdoor pipes and fixtures if temperatures are expected to drop below freezing for extended periods. Our team can provide guidance on winterization best practices.

Q. How do you drain an outdoor shower?
A. Outdoor showers can be drained in several ways, depending on local regulations, soil type, and the amount of water being used. Common methods include:
- Simple gravel bed: A permeable base where water soaks directly into the ground.
- French drain: An underground trench with a perforated pipe that redirects water away from the shower area.
- Connection to existing septic or sewer system: Directly integrates the shower's drainage into your home's wastewater system.
- Greywater system: Collects and filters the shower water for reuse in landscaping.
We assess your property to recommend the most effective and compliant drainage solution for your Wadmalaw home.
